directions

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ees.
  • Mix dry ingredients and seasonings.
  • Add eggs, strawberries, and oil.
  • Beat well with mixer.
  • Pour into greased bundt pan.
  • Bake 1 hour at 350 degrees.
  • Cool slightly before removing from pan.
  • .Glaze.
  • 1/4 cup strawberry juice.
  • 1 to 2 tablespoons melted butter.
  • 2 cups powdered sugar.
  • Beat all with mixer until smooth.
  • Drizzle over warm cake.
